Step into history with Lennel, a majestic Victorian residence nestled in the heart of Invercargill's historic Gladstone suburb. Named after the ancient Coldstream in Scotland, Lennel was meticulously crafted by renowned surveyor John Turnbull Thomson between 1880-1882, evoking the essence of his Northumbrian childhood home in Glororum.

With its imposing stature and rich heritage, Lennel offers a glimpse into a bygone era while presenting a myriad of opportunities for the discerning buyer. Boasting 8 spacious bedrooms, expansive living areas, and historic charm at every turn, this sprawling estate spans across approximately 3 acres, where natural beauty reigns supreme, with Thomson's own cherished bushland providing a picturesque backdrop.

Beyond its architectural grandeur, Lennel holds a profound significance in Invercargill's history, reflecting Thomson's pioneering spirit and lasting contributions to New Zealand's surveying legacy. As New Zealand's first Surveyor-General and a key figure in the development of Otago and Southland, Thomson's influence reverberates through the very fabric of this storied residence.
